How do political executive have more power than the permanent executive?

The political executives have more power than the permanent ones. Since the will of the people is supreme in a democracy, the ministers elected by the people are empowered to exercise the will of the people on their behalf. It is the political executive which is ultimately answerable to the people for all consequences. The minister takes the advice of the experts on all technical matters and then finally decides the issue.


What is popular sovereingnty?

Popular sovereignty is the principle that the authority of the government is created and sustained by the consent of its people. They are elected through representatives and are the source of all political power.

What according to Friedrich Nietzsche is the source of all virtue?

According to Friedrich Nietzsche, the source of all virtue is individual self-mastery. He believed that true virtue comes from a person's ability to overcome societal norms and restrictions to create their own values and meaning in life. Nietzsche valued autonomy and personal empowerment as the key sources of virtue.

What is is popular sovereignty?

Popular sovereignty indicates that the mandate of the people created government, and that political power comes from the people. However, in practice, political leaders abuse their power because they consider themselves sovereigns, instead of public servants. --- It is the basic principle of the American system of government; that the people are the only source of any and all American governmental power, that government must be conducted with the consent of the governed. --- Popular sovereignty is the belief that the state is created by the mandate of its people, who are the source of all political power. It is closely associated to the social contract philosophers, among whom are Thomas Hobbes, john Locke and Jean-Jacques Rousseau. The notion that power lies with the people
